Obituary for Ellen Marion Levick (Beach)

Ellen Marion  Levick (Beach)
Peacefully, on Wednesday, September 17,
2014 at the age of 95. Beloved wife of the late
Leslie Levick former farmers of the South
Gower Township. Loving mother of Carolyn
Levere, Joan Bartlett (Paul), and Vicki
Classen (Jim). Cherished grandmother of
Sean, Judson, Brett, Jeremy, Mark, Leslie,
Adam, and Joe. Adoring great-grandmother
of Tyler, Jordan, Makenna, Danielle, Matthew,
Katelyn, Keaton, Rowan, Brody, Camden,
Ellamae, and Hazel. Predeceased by her
parents Robert and Clara Beach (ne ́e Wilson)
and by her brother Arnold and sister Grace.
Family and Friends are invited to visit at the
Brown Chapel of Hulse, Playfair &
McGarry, 805 Prescott Street, Kemptville
on Saturday, September 27, 2014 from 10:30
AM until time of Memorial Service in the
Chapel at 12:00 p.m. In lieu of flowers, a
donation may be made to the Canadian
Cancer Society or the Heart and Stroke
Foundation.
